Introduction

In today's fast-paced world, the traditional 9-5 working arrangements not any longer fits the requirements of many people. With additional parents working unusual hours, shift work, or overnight shifts, the interest in 24-hour daycare services is increasing. This short article explore the theoretical implications of 24-hour daycare, talking about the possibility benefits and challenges related to offering around-the-clock maintain children.

The many benefits of 24-Hour Daycare

Using the option to disappear and get their children at any time associated with time or night, moms and dads can better balance their particular work and family members responsibilities. This flexibility may be especially very theraputic for parents just who work non-traditional hours or over night shifts, because it permits them discover childcare that aligns due to their work schedule.

Furthermore, 24-hour daycare often helps support moms and dads that following degree or training programs that need all of them to wait classes or work during non-traditional hours. By giving childcare services anyway hours, parents can pursue their particular academic objectives and never have to worry about finding maintain kids during class or research time.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are may be the potential for increased socialization and discovering possibilities for children. By being in a daycare setting for extended intervals, kids have significantly more opportunities to connect to their particular peers, take part in structured tasks, and study on competent caregivers. This extensive amount of time in daycare will kiddies develop social abilities, build connections, and boost their intellectual and psychological development.

Also, 24-hour daycare can offer a secure and protected environment for kids during instances when moms and dads might not be offered to take care of all of them. For parents just who work over night shifts or have actually volatile schedules, comprehending that kids are in a secure and nurturing environment can offer satisfaction and alleviate a few of the anxiety related to managing work and parenting responsibilities.

The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are lots of potential benefits to 24-hour daycare, there are several challenges that must definitely be considered. One of several primary challenges is the prospective impact on children's sleep schedules and overall well being. Research has shown that disrupted rest patterns might have side effects on kid's cognitive development, behavior, and general health. Providing childcare services anyway hours could make it difficult for kids to ascertain constant rest routines, that could have lasting implications with their well-being.

Additionally, keeping top-quality care and supervision during over night hours could be difficult. Caregivers whom work overnight shifts may go through tiredness and reduced attentiveness, which may influence their ability to deliver the exact same degree of attention and direction as they would during daytime hours. Making certain caregivers are well-rested, supported, and taught to offer high quality treatment during over night hours is important to mitigating these challenges.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the potential for increased prices for families. Providing childcare services 24 hours a day needs additional staffing, resources, and functional expenses, that could bring about higher charges for parents. For families already struggling to afford childcare, the added expense of 24-hour care might prohibitive and limit their accessibility these types of services.
